Goat format ruling
Chain Energy

Card effect (current official text)Each player must pay 500 Life Points per card to Normal Summon, Special Summon, Set or activate cards from his/her respective hand.
Rulings
- Chain Energy applies only to cards played or Set from your hand, not cards that are activated when already Set on the field, or to cards placed onto the field by effects like Cyber Jar’s Flip Effect.
- "Chain Energy" applies to any cards played after "Chain Energy" resolves.
- "Chain Energy" creates a condition where you pay an activation cost of 500 LP to play a card. A card is defined as played by either putting it on the field through normal means; for example, a Normal Summon/Set, Activating a Spell Card from the Hand, Setting a Spell/Trap Card, or activating a discarding effect like "Kuriboh" from the hand.
- Cards Set previous to "Chain Energy" do not trigger the 500 LP cost.
- Cards brought to the field through another effect, like Special Summoning a monster through "Monster Reborn" do not trigger the 500 LP cost of "Chain Energy".
- Q: If I have only 500 LP remaining with "Chain Energy" applying on the field, can I activate "Poison of the Old Man" to increase my LP before losing the 500 points from the effect of "Chain Energy" and losing the Duel? A: When you play the Poision of the Old Man Chain Energy will cause you to pay 500 LP, reducing your LP to 0 before Poison of the Old Man can resolve.
